Art and Community: Building Connections Through Creativity:        Creativity is a valuable skill and useful tool for developing new ideas, increasing efficiency and devising solutions to complex problems.

Art has an incredible ability to bring people together, transcending boundaries and fostering a sense of community. Community art projects, in particular, play a crucial role in creating shared experiences and building connections.

These projects often invite people from all walks of life to collaborate, regardless of age, background, or artistic experience. Whether it’s a mural, a public sculpture, or a collaborative painting, the process of creating art together encourages dialogue, teamwork, and mutual respect. Participants share their stories, express their creativity, and, in doing so, discover common ground.

Art centers and community organizations play a pivotal role in facilitating projects by providing resources, guidance, and a platform for expression, they help harness the collective creative energy of the community. Workshops, open studios, and collaborative exhibitions further enhance engagement, allowing people to explore different art forms and express themselves freely.

In a world where digital communication often dominates, community art projects offer a refreshing and tangible way to connect. They remind us of the power of creativity in building bridges and creating inclusive spaces where everyone’s voice is valued. Through art, we not only beautify our surroundings but also strengthen the bonds that hold our communities together.

Vintage or Just Old

Vintage quilts were made from the 1930 to 1965. Quilts deemed antique date back to 100 years or more. Now you have it. Stop calling all those quilts you made in 1980 antiques. Yes, its 2022 and it seemed like ages ago that you made those first quilts. 
Discarded and donated quilts can be found while browsing antique shops, donation centers or second hand establishments. I bet you will find what I found…old quilts. Mostly handstitched and even worn and tattered somewhat. Some may be in very good condition. You share and admire the handwork and wonder from what attic, trunk or closet they emerged. Who brought them there surely did not have an attachment to them. They are usually and mostly undocumented without any type of label. 
Should you cut it up and make it into a jacket, vest, table runner cover or a foot stool? Well that is definitely a topic for another day. Today, let us just celebrate old and vintage quilt finds. Let us celebrate those hands and hearts who put labor and love into each and every stitch and snip. If they get used up, its ok, that was their purpose. If they are displayed for their beautiful workmanship, that was the purpose. 
Just enjoy the quilt, however you choose.                 
Vintage or just old, it does not matter.
